Feminism in London 08 is a one-day conference on feminism in London . With a theme of "the power of women", the day will feature some of the many feminist activist groups that are campaigning in and around London. There will be talks, workshops and a chance to network. The event is for women and pro-feminist men.
Admission: £3 waged, £1 students and unwaged
